Understanding Automated Investigation in Cybersecurity

At its core, automated investigation refers to the use of advanced tools and technologies such as Artificial Intelligence (AI) and Machine Learning (ML) to automatically identify, analyze, and respond to security threats. Unlike traditional manual investigation methods, automation accelerates detection times, reduces human error, and enables security teams to handle complex threats at scale.

This process involves real-time data analysis, correlation of events from multiple sources, and intelligent threat classification, allowing MSPs to prioritize alerts accurately and respond swiftly.

How Automated Investigation Works: Technologies Behind the Innovation

Implementing automated investigation for managed security providers involves a synergy of several cutting-edge technologies:

  1. Threat Intelligence Integration: Incorporating real-time feeds from threat intelligence sources enhances detection capabilities.
  2. Behavioral Analytics: AI analyzes user and system behaviors to identify anomalies indicative of malicious activity.
  3. Automated Alert Correlation: Sifting through massive volumes of logs and events to connect related incidents.
  4. Machine Learning Models: Continuously evolve and improve detection accuracy by learning from past incidents and patterns.
  5. Orchestration and Automation Tools: Streamline workflows from detection to response, automating containment and remediation actions.

These technologies enable MSPs to transform raw data into actionable intelligence, ensuring swift and precise responses.

Future Trends in Automated Investigations for Managed Security Providers

The cybersecurity landscape is perpetually evolving, and so are the tactics and tools for automated investigations. Looking forward, the following trends are poised to shape the future:

  • AI-Driven Dynamic Playbooks: Automated responses that adapt based on evolving threats and organizational contexts.
  • Enhanced Threat Hunting: Proactive search techniques powered by automation to discover hidden threats.
  • Integration of Zero Trust Architecture: Automating policy enforcement to minimize attack surfaces.
  • Greater Use of Deception Technologies: Automated deployment of honeypots and decoys to trap attackers.
  • Hybrid Human-AI Collaboration: Leveraging human expertise alongside AI for optimal incident management.

These innovations will further empower MSPs to deliver proactive, resilient security services leveraging last-generation automation technologies.
